#0bb13a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#0bb13a is composed of 4.3% red, 69.4% green and 22.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 93.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 67.2% yellow and 30.6% black. It has a hue angle of 137 degrees, a saturation of 88.3% and a lightness of 36.9%. #0bb13a color hex could be obtained by blending #16ff74 with #006300. Closest websafe color is: #009933.

Shades and Tints of #0bb13a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010b04 is the darkest color, while #f7fff9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#0bb13a

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5b615c is the less saturated color, while #04b837 is the most saturated one.
